Instructions
Heat a skillet over medium heat and add the butter.
Once the butter is melted, add the corn and stir well.
Cook the corn for 5-7 minutes until tender, stirring occasionally.
Drizzle in the honey and mix to coat the corn evenly.
If desired, add heavy cream for extra creaminess and stir until combined.
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
Remove from heat and garnish with fresh parsley if desired.
Serve warm and enjoy!
Notes
You can use fresh, frozen, or canned corn for this recipe. If using canned corn, be sure to drain it well.
